The Atlanta Hawks will be without veteran point guard Rajon Rondo for at least the next three games, according to the team.

Rondo will enter a period of rest and rehabilitation to strengthen his right knee and will be reviewed prior to the team’s three-game West Coast trip, the team announced.

If the timetable given by the Hawks holds up, Rondo will miss two games against the Charlotte Hornets (Jan. 6 and Jan. 9) and one against the Philadelphia 76ers (Jan. 11).

He will then have the opportunity to return against the Phoenix Suns on Jan. 13.

The 34-year-old has played two games this season, averaging 6.0 points and 7.0 assists per game.
